鍍金池/ 問答/PHP/ PHP 有可以隨意移動(dòng)免安裝的版本嗎?

PHP 有可以隨意移動(dòng)免安裝的版本嗎?

最近C#要寫一個(gè)算法 他要跟PHP的加密算法得到的結(jié)果是一樣的,由于各種編碼非常難統(tǒng)一。所以想在程序中 嵌入一個(gè)PHP功能,然后通過CMD 來運(yùn)行PHP代碼 來計(jì)算這個(gè)加密算法。

要求是這樣的:要制作一個(gè)PHP,無論在win7 或者是 win10下 無論是 32位還是64位系統(tǒng)。都能直接運(yùn)行。

請問 這個(gè)有沒有辦法實(shí)現(xiàn)? 我看了一下phpstudy 好像他可以解壓就能用。但不知怎么辦,我把phpstudy里面的PHP 移動(dòng)到本機(jī)的任何地方,它都能正常運(yùn)行,但我移動(dòng)的別的電腦,它就不行了。

回答
編輯回答
半心人

php不都是解壓就可以用免安裝的嗎;
關(guān)于版本:如果你要在32位或者64位系統(tǒng)的都可以運(yùn)行,最好是下載32位的就可以了。
關(guān)于cmd運(yùn)行: php是可以在cli模式下運(yùn)行的,也就是windows的cmd下是可以直接運(yùn)行的。
具體步驟:

  1. http://php.net/downloads.php 下載一個(gè)32位的安裝包解壓;

  2. 把你解壓的安裝包的bin目錄添加到系統(tǒng)環(huán)境變量

  3. cmd切換到你寫php文件所在的目錄 然后運(yùn)行 php 你的文件名.php

2018年8月22日 11:50
編輯回答
扯不斷

不清楚為什么你要這么做,直接用32位的phpstudy是可以在64位系統(tǒng)運(yùn)行的,而php本身就是由C寫出來的,所以可以在命令行很好的運(yùn)行它,只是配置對了路徑。

2017年10月4日 13:42
編輯回答
愛礙唉

搞集成是考驗(yàn)功力的,除了編譯之外,基本沒有.最好是接口到服務(wù)器處理.

2017年9月13日 22:09